
Obituary: Baritone Jack O’Kelly Passes Away
Baritone Jack O’Kelly has passed away. O’Kelly was a chorus member at the Welch National Opera for nearly 40 years. “Madama Butterly,” “Tosca,” and “La Traviata” were a few of his regularly performed operas.
